Issue 1070: Fix updates not scheduling
Description
Fix to sometimes background updates not happening.
Screenshots
Technical details
Background updates are not happening probably because AuthData is not being passed around properly.
Tests
Issues
https://gitlab.e.foundation/e/os/backlog/-/issues/1070
10 commandments of code reviews
Edited by Sayantan Roychowdhury